出 处:《汽车技术》2004年第10期13-15,共3页Automobile Technology
摘 要:以油耗较高的标致505SX型车为研究对象,在其XN1A发动机上应用发动机管理系统开展了降低油耗与排放的研究工作。通过发动机管理系统选型、发动机台架标定试验、整车标定试验等研究工作,开发了XN1A发动机燃油喷射电控系统与电控点火系统,并进行了发动机外特性及万有特性的测试。试验结果表明,该发动机管理系统能使发动机及整车燃油消耗明显降低,其动力性优于原化油器式发动机,排放性能也有所改善。Taking PEUGEOT505SX car,with a high fuel consumption,as an investigated example,the engine man-age ment system is used on its XN1A engine to reduce fuel consumption and exhaust emission.Through type selection of en gine man agement system,calibration tests on engine testing benches,calibration tests on vehicle,the electronically con-trolled fuel injection system and the electronically controlled ignition system of XN1A engine are developed.The en gine outer characteristic and the fuel consumption map are measured.It is shown by tests that the engine management system can evidently reduce fuel consumption of either engine or vehicle,and the power performance is better than the original carburetor engine,and exhaust emission is also improved.
